Ticket: Cron drift investigation for the Saltgrove nightly reconciliation job. Over three weeks, the job's start time drifted from 02:00 to 02:47 because each run rescheduled itself relative to completion rather than a fixed anchor. The proposed fix pins scheduling to a wall-clock anchor with a jitter window of ±90 seconds, and adds a drift alarm at five minutes. Reviewers should check the timezone handling around the Marrowdale DST boundary carefully. Before merge, sign-off is required from the engineer named below.

named custodian: Belius Casath Ulaix Sorius

## Runbook: Shipping SquatterNet Scanner Updates

Heads up, support folks — when we push a new ruleset to the SquatterNet typo-squatting scanner, registries won't pick it up until the signed manifest lands. If customers report the scanner missing obvious lookalike packages after a release, nine times out of ten the manifest signing step got skipped. Check the publish log first. If you need to re-run the signing job yourself, it expects the current deploy key, which follows.

rollout seal: bky19_M1Zvn1YQwEBTy4XxP3H

Ticket: Quiet Room, Level 9

Hey facilities folks — the quiet room on the top floor of the Marwick building has been locked since the weekend deep-clean, and a few of us from the Pexel team use it daily for focus blocks. Could someone swing by and reset the reader? The booking panel outside still shows it as available, which is confusing people. In the meantime, staff who need access can use the temporary pass below until the reader is sorted.

staff pass of kagup-fajog = bdg-QCHVQW-99665837

MEMO — Heads of Department

Re: Licensing dispute with Verrandale Systems

Verrandale contends our Luminek module exceeds the seat count permitted under the 2021 agreement. Counsel at Hartwell & Brume is reviewing usage logs before we respond. Please suspend any new Luminek deployments until cleared. The outcome may shape our posture on the matter below.

board note of fahag-tajop: The eastern region missed its Julix quota by 44.0 percent last quarter. Ralionax Holdings plans to lower the Druath list price by 61.8 percent in March. The board signed off on a budget of $295.0 million for Project Gilath. The renewal with Ruswynix Systems closes at $274.5 million a year, 17.0 percent above the last contract.